I actually bought this FastRack to replace one of the old school round plastic bottle trees that was the only real option when I started brewing. My bottle tree had stacking rings and could hold up to 90 bottles but was bulky and awkward to deal with. It didn't store nicely because it's round, the bottles hung on the pegs, and the whole thing would shake and rattle if you bumped into it. It was hard to relocate because you couldn't pick it up or the rings would come apart. About the only benefit was the pump bottle sanitizer that sat on top.FastRack on the other hand stacks easily, is super stable as long as you put same size bottles at all four corners, has handles for easy moving even when loaded, has a compact footprint (basically the size of a 24 bottle case), and is a normal rectangular shape. The bottles are held by the neck so nothing touches the inside, which is important if you're using it to hold clean and sanitized bottles. They also sit upside down so everything will drain. If you buy this kit you get the tray to catch drips and keep your floor or shelf clean.The price is good, and it's made in USA! You can get by storing in old cases or plastic totes but this is really the ideal bottle storage.
